In topsy-turvy Haryana politics, Sonipat latest amphitheatre for BJP-Cong. fight

Bharatiya Janata Party’s Rajiv Jain, the outgoing mayor of Sonipat Municipal Corporation and the party’s nominee for the May 10 mayoral poll, made an unannounced visit to Nirankari Bhawan on Railway Road on Sunday. Skipping the usual cavalcade and crowd of supporters, Mr. Jain attended a ‘satsang (religious gathering)’ before kicking off a packed day…

Madhya Pradesh Elections On November 17, Result On December 3

Five states will go to polls this year including Madhya Pradesh. New Delhi: The voting for the Madhya Pradesh assembly elections will be held on November 17 with the counting of votes scheduled for December 3, the Election Commission announced today.  The 230-member Madhya Pradesh Legislative Assembly is currently led by the BJP, which has…
